Figure 1

Network model of research papers on Ebola. Each node represents one paper of the 20% most cited papers on Ebola, and the edges represent the citations between the documents. The shape of the nodes indicates to which cluster (research front) they belong. The color of the nodes is according to a continuous scale from red to blue. This scale is a function of the clinical terms rate, so a red node could be considered a basic research paper, a purple one translational research, and a blue node is a clinical observation article.
